How material choice affects ingredient stability

The wrong packaging material can mess with your product faster than you think. Some ingredients react badly to plasticizers or metals, leading to serious ingredient degradation. That’s why high-end brands often go for glass or PET—they offer better chemical resistance, keeping those precious active ingredients safe and stable.

  • Glass is inert and ideal for sensitive actives like retinol.
  • PET resists moisture and oxygen better than standard plastics.
  • Avoid PVC; it can leach chemicals into formulas.

In short, the right materials help extend your product’s shelf life while preserving its full benefits.

Certifications and standards: ISO 9001, FDA, REACH compliance

When picking out your next batch of skin care containers, check if the supplier hits all the right marks—literally. Certifications ensure every bottle meets strict safety rules across global markets.

ISO 9001 = solid quality management

FDA-compliant materials = safe for skin contact

REACH compliance = passes tough EU-level material regulations

Certification Focus Area Regulatory Body Region
ISO 9001 Process & consistency ISO Global
FDA Health & safety U.S. FDA United States
REACH Chemical transparency ECHA Europe

These aren’t just stamps—they reflect real trust in manufacturing quality and environmental responsibility.

Pump Vs Dropper In Skin Care Containers

Choosing the right dispenser for your product isn’t just about looks—it’s about function, hygiene, and user experience.

Pump

When it comes to thicker skincare products like cream, gel, or high-viscosity serum, a pump mechanism is often the go-to. Here’s how it breaks down:

A. Functionality & Control

• Pumps offer consistent dosing, so you don’t overdo it.

• Their design limits exposure to air, keeping formulas stable longer—especially useful for sensitive emulsions.

B. Hygiene & Preservation

1. The mostly airless system helps prevent oxidation and contamination.

2. This is crucial for active ingredients that degrade quickly when exposed to oxygen or light.

C. Compatibility with Product Types

• Works best with mid-to-high viscosity products like lotions and thick serums.

• Not ideal for watery solutions due to flow limitations.

D. User Experience Factors

1. Easy one-hand use makes pumps super convenient in daily routines.

2. Less mess—no dripping or spills like you might get from open-mouth jars or tubes.

In short, if you’re packaging a rich moisturizer or a dense anti-aging formula in your skin care container, a pump brings both cleanliness and convenience to the table.

Dropper

Droppers shine when precision matters—and that’s often the case with concentrated skincare formulas housed in glass bottles.

  • You get exact control over dosage; just squeeze and release.
  • Ideal for lightweight liquids like botanical oils, water-based actives, or any aqueous, low-viscosity blend.
  • Because of their delicate nature, droppers are usually paired with more fragile, premium-looking containers—think amber glass vials on your vanity.
  • They’re especially great when applying treatment serums drop by drop onto targeted areas—like dark spots or fine lines.
  • That said, they can be less sanitary if not handled properly since they’re exposed during application.
  • Also worth noting: while elegant, droppers aren’t always travel-friendly—they can leak if not sealed tightly.

So if you’re bottling something potent and fluid in your line of skin care containers, a dropper might be the smarter move—for both precision and presentation.

PET vs. HDPE barrier performance comparison

Material Type Oxygen Transmission Rate (cc/m²/day) Moisture Barrier Chemical Resistance
PET plastic 2–6 Moderate Excellent
HDPE plastic 150–200 High Good

PET wins when it comes to blocking oxygen—its low permeability makes it a go-to for sensitive formulations in modern skin care containers. For brands aiming at longevity and stability, PET is simply smarter than HDPE.

Traditional jars: contamination and oxidation risks

  • Traditional jars get opened again and again, letting air sneak in every time. That’s where the trouble starts.
  • Contaminants from fingers or spatulas mix with your product, inviting bacterial growth that can mess with your skin big time.
  • The more air exposure, the faster ingredients break down—cue oxidation, which leads to serious ingredient degradation.
  1. Open jar → exposed formula
  2. Exposed formula → higher chance of spoilage
  3. Spoiled product = irritation or wasted money

Not just gross—this also means more preservatives are needed to keep things shelf-stable, which isn’t ideal for sensitive skin types.
